Release checklist — Crumbwell cutoff rule

[ ] Confirm the bakery order-cutoff now evaluates in the store's local timezone, not server time. Late-night orders in Fennbrook were sneaking past the 6 p.m. cutoff. Quick check of the audit log shows correct rejections. Sign-off pinned to the build token below.

trace token, tawep-fahif: htk3_b58

Team,

As discussed at last month's review, Quillstone Retail will open three branches across Norvenna during the coming year, starting with Aldercliff. Fit-out contracts are signed and regional recruitment begins next month. Branch managers should expect secondment requests for experienced supervisors. Supply routing will run through the Marwick depot until the regional hub opens. The confidential business-plan note from the executive office appears below.

Regards,
Dorren Haxley, Operations Director

board note of kagep-yahig: Only 9 of the 120 pilot accounts renewed Quenix, so a churn review is set for April 1.

Management Meeting Minutes — Second-Source Supplier Search

Attendees: heads of department, chaired by T. Varmel. Procurement reported progress on identifying a second source for the Kelstrand valve assemblies. Three candidates in the Orvane district passed initial quality screening; audits are scheduled over the next six weeks. Risks noted: tooling transfer costs and a possible four-month qualification lag. Logistics will model dual-sourcing freight impacts. The confidential planning note follows below.

confidential, hahap-taweg: Headcount on the Zorath team goes from 7 to 140 by the end of January. Gross margin on Zorath came in at 15 percent against a plan of 20 percent.